Yes the radiator fan is really loud and creating lots of vibration. Something is wrong with the fan i guess. Hope changing the radiator fan solves the issue as my car is still under extended warranty.

There is a plastic knob holding the fan in place and most probably it has broken, happens many a times. If there is a vibration even after you switch off your engine then I suggest you to check for that knob. The service guys will just change the knob/screw and I hope that sorts out the issue.

I have the '16 petrol EcoSport (AT). If you drive for a while with the a/c running and switch off the engine, there are occasions when the fan remains running even after you've switched off the engine and locked the car. To avoid this (potentially drain the battery), after I reach my destination, I tend to wait for a few seconds until the fan switches off and then turn off the car.

Update: Ac of my ecosport stopped working all of a sudden yesterday. Took it to Ford service today. The radiator fan had gone kaput. The same was replaced under warranty and thankfully got my car today itself. The loud sound from radiator fan is gone now.
